ASEAN countries are diverse, with GDP per capita ranging from about USD1,297 in Myanmar, a lower-middle income country, to USD64,041 in Singapore, a high-income advanced economy (World Economic Outlook Database, IMF, April 2019). ASEAN marked its 50th anniversary in 2017 with relatively successful and prosperous development in five decades, with establishment of the ASEAN Economic Community in 2015 as one the key milestones as well as the achievements of Millennium Development Goals 2015. Building on the past successes via Millennium Development Goals 2015, especially in areas such as poverty eradication, better health outcomes and quality education, ASEAN countries are poised to make a more inclusive progress towards the newly adopted development agenda of Sustainable Development Goals 2030 (SDG 2030), which cover a wider set of interlinked development objectives under its 17 goals. The economic dynamism of the ASEAN region on the back of its strong income growth, continuous structural transformation and infrastructure improvements is expected to support sustainable development in the region. From the IMF Report (September 2018), most ASEAN countries, with their continued income growth and strong policy efforts, are on track to eradicate absolute poverty by 2030, while some of these countries are already doing well in terms of gender equality. Similarly, improvement in universal primary education completion is one of the key progress areas made by the majority of ASEAN countries. Despite these achievements, challenges persist, hence, we need to ensure a more inclusive and environmentally sustainable development in the region. Income inequality remains relatively high in several countries, and the shift towards manufacturing has strained environmental sustainability in the region. Book excerpt: Individual and group behavior has been studied over time by different scholars involving various loci (Ackfedt & Coote, 2005; Miles & Mangold, 2005; Yi & Gong, 2012). Studies revealed that besides employees' daily responsibilities, they engage in extra-role behaviors that help their employer organization. Consumer research literature revealed that these behaviors contribute greatly to customer satisfaction. This study employed a correlational approach to determine the interaction between organizational citizenship behaviors (OCB) and job satisfaction of the employees of Microtel Inn and Suites Philippines. Customer satisfaction was measured as an independent variable and was interpreted based on the results. Two sets of questionnaires were distributed among employees and customers. The employee questionnaire focused on OCB and job satisfaction while the customer questionnaire focused on customer satisfaction. Focus group discussion was employed to further validate the results of the study. Thus, this paper shows the other perspectives of OCB in the workplace, contrary to the findings of other researches which focused on the positive effects of OCB.

Book excerpt: The purpose of this study is to examine if employees of small hotels in Kingston, Jamaica, are satisfied with the realization of their motivational preferences. This study also focuses on the relationship between dependant motivational preferences, such as Pay and Appreciation, and independent variables, such as Gender and Age. Research was conducted through quantitative and qualitative elements. The quantitative instrument was a structured questionnaire. An unstructured interview with hotel managers in Kingston was the qualitative portion of the study. The study generated a response rate of over 80 percent from six different small hotels in Kingston. The survey was statistically analyzed using SPSS. Results of the study revealed that employees are dissatisfied with three of the five most important motivational preferences, such as Pay and Appreciation. Further, the study found that the independent variables Age, Gender, Education and Tenure influence the satisfaction with the dependant variables. This study will help to indicate areas that need attention from a managerial standpoint and it will contribute to job satisfaction research in general.

This book was released on 2019 with total page 0 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Increasing organizational survivability has no longer become an option, but a must. This may well be due to the impact of globalization, which has not only opened up international trade, but also increasing international competition (Evans, Pucik, & Bjorkman, 2011; Hubbard, Rice, & Beamish, 2008; Thompson, Gamble, & Strickland III, 2004). In the rush of international trade and competition in much of borderless nations these days, Organizational Citizenship Behavior (OCB), as a passive construct, has been proven to be beneficial for both employees and employers alike (Bergeron, Shipp, Rosen, & Furst, 2011; Mohanty & Rath, 2012; Nielsen, Bachrach, Sundstrom, & Halfhill, 2012; Noor, 2009; Yaghoubi, Mashinchi, & Hadi, 2010; Özturk, 2010). This study seeks to analyze OCB in trying to determine its most influential factor. By far, previous researches have indicated that factors of job satisfaction have the most influence towards OCB (Intaraprasong, Dityen, Krugkrunjit, & Subhadrabandhu, 2012; Mohammad, Habib, & Alias, 2011; Swaminathan & Jawahar, 2013). The main purpose of this research is to single out the most influential element of job satisfaction towards OCB that can be managed or controlled in some way by organizations. Data gathering is performed by means of questionnaire distributions in 4-star hotels in Jakarta. Data analysis and testing are computed in statistical software to note the level of correlations and influences of elements of job satisfaction towards OCB. However, strength of influence barely hits minimum, providing a base for future research on other factors that may be more influential towards OCB.

Book excerpt: This research investigates the role of organizational justice (distributive, procedural, and interactional) in predicting job satisfaction and turnover intention in an emerging market. A survey of 343 hospitality employees in Vietnam revealed that all three aspects of organizational justice positively influence job satisfaction and negatively influence turnover intention. The findings suggest that employees in this industry prioritize consistent application of job decisions (distributive and procedural justice) over interactional justice. Additionally, job satisfaction was found to negatively impact turnover intention. These results contribute to the understanding of the relationship between organizational justice and turnover intention.
